Enter the void with cutting-edge technology and McGregor’s experimental movement.


Since the beginning of time, humankind has had a fascination with the void. From deep sea to deep space, these dark mysterious zones ignite both our imagination and our desire to explore our world to its limits.

In Deepstaria – a title inspired by an enigmatic species of jellyfish with a stellar-sounding name – Wayne McGregor conjures a highly sensory, meditative pure dance and acoustic experience which reflects on our profound relationship with the void and our own mortality.

Utilising Vantablack Vision® technology on stage to create unfathomable darkness, McGregor visions an environment that disturbs traditional hierarchies of perception. In this void, acoustic imagery and animative music by Oscar-winning sound designer Nicolas Becker and renowned music producer LEXX create a sonic dreamscape that is continuously recomposed and performed by revolutionary digital audio engine Bronze AI – thus re-configuring the relationship between live dance and live recorded music in real time.
